Output 64f340936ed362488905b0fad33e426c1f5db782d17f2b95e89084b49adf023e:2

value
2471676
script pubkey
OP_0 OP_PUSHBYTES_32 0bdf39ef176a441708b950ff8542b02cc425b4a0cd1b19a188103a092dd2af68
address
bc1qp00nnmchdfzpwz9e2rlc2s4s9nzztd9qe5d3ngvgzqaqjtwj4a5qytv2n8
transaction
64f340936ed362488905b0fad33e426c1f5db782d17f2b95e89084b49adf023e
spent
true